Description
Thioacetic Acid S-[4-[4-(4-Acetylsulfanylphenylethynyl)-Phenylethynyl]-Phenyl] Ester is a specialized organic compound featuring a unique conjugated structure with multiple acetyl-protected thiol and ethynyl groups. This molecular architecture makes it a valuable advanced intermediate for constructing complex, functionalized materials and electronic components. It is primarily utilized by R&D chemists and material scientists in the fields of organic electronics, polymer synthesis, and advanced material science.
Application
- Organic Semiconductor Precursor: Serves as a key building block for synthesizing conjugated polymers and small molecules used in OLEDs, OFETs, and organic photovoltaics.
- Functionalized Material Synthesis: Used to introduce protected thiol and acetylene functionalities into molecular frameworks for advanced material development.
- Cross-linking Agent: Acts as a precursor for generating reactive thiol groups in situ, facilitating polymer cross-linking and network formation.
- Ligand and Catalyst Development: Employed in the synthesis of complex ligands for catalysis or as a scaffold for metal-organic frameworks (MOFs).
- Pharmaceutical Intermediate: Potential use in the research and development of novel drug candidates requiring specific sulfur-containing motifs.
- Surface Modification: Can be used to create self-assembled monolayers (SAMs) on metal surfaces for sensor or electronic applications.
Basic Information
| Product Name | Thioacetic Acid S-[4-[4-(4-Acetylsulfanylphenylethynyl)-Phenylethynyl]-Phenyl] Ester |
| CAS No. | 267007-83-0 |
| Molecular Formula | C26H16O2S2 |
| Molecular Weight | 424.54 g/mol |
| Synonyms | S-[4-[4-(4-Acetylsulfanylphenylethynyl)phenylethynyl]phenyl] ethanethioate; 1,4-Bis(4-(acetylthio)phenylethynyl)benzene; Bis[4-(acetylthio)phenylethynyl]benzene; 4,4'-(1,4-Phenylene-bis(ethyne-2,1-diyl))bis(thioanisol); Thioacetic Acid S-[4-[4-(4-Acetylsulfanylphenylethynyl)-Phenylethynyl]-Phenyl] Ester; CAS 267007-83-0 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). This compound is light-sensitive; prolonged exposure to light should be avoided to prevent decomposition. Keep the container tightly sealed to minimize exposure to atmospheric moisture.
